Systematic name YGR037C
Gene name ACB1
Aliases
Feature type ORF, Verified
Coordinates Chr VII:559998..559735
Don't edit this box! It's automatically regenerated, and edits will be lost when the update script runs.


Description of YGR037C: Acyl-CoA-binding protein, transports newly synthesized acyl-CoA esters from fatty acid synthetase (Fas1p-Fas2p) to acyl-CoA-consuming processes[1][2]
